Overview
CENEPETROLEUM TERMINAL (MERGE W/1130003) is a refined product pipeline facility located 2 miles south of McPherson, Kansas, United States. It operates under US PHMSA and DOT 49 CFR Part 195 regulations.
CENEPETROLEUM TERMINAL (MERGE W/1130003) is a refined product pipeline facility situated in McPherson County, Kansas, approximately 2 miles south of the city of McPherson. As a refined product pipeline, it is part of the infrastructure that transports petroleum products such as gasoline, diesel, and jet fuel. The facility is operational and classified under NAICS code 486910, which covers pipeline transportation of refined petroleum products. The facility operates under the regulatory framework of the United States, specifically the Pipeline and Hazardous Materials Safety Administration (PHMSA) and the Department of Transportation (DOT) 49 CFR Part 195, which governs hazardous liquid pipelines. This regulatory regime requires rigorous safety standards, including corrosion control, leak detection, and emergency response planning. The facility's location in central Kansas places it within a region with extensive pipeline networks connecting refineries to distribution terminals. Refined product pipelines like this one play a critical role in the energy supply chain, ensuring reliable delivery of fuels to local markets. The McPherson area is an agricultural and industrial hub, and the terminal supports regional fuel distribution. Environmental considerations include proximity to waterways and populated areas, which are managed through PHMSA-mandated integrity management programs.
